Description
Homemade Pumpkin Spice Banana Bread merges comforting autumn flavors with classic quick bread charm. Warm spices and ripe bananas create a moist, flavorful loaf perfect for enjoying with coffee or sharing with friends.
Ingredients
Scale
Main Ingredients:
- 2 ripe bananas, mashed
- 1/2 cup pumpkin puree
- 2 large eggs
- 1/2 cup unsalted butter, softened
- 1 cup granulated sugar
Dry Ingredients:
- 1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
- 1 teaspoon baking soda
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1 teaspoon pumpkin spice
Flavoring:
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
Instructions
- Warm the oven to 350°F and coat a loaf pan with a light layer of grease to prevent sticking.
- Combine the dry ingredients in a medium mixing bowl, whisking flour, baking soda, salt, and pumpkin spice until evenly distributed.
- In a separate large bowl, blend butter and sugar using an electric mixer until the mixture becomes pale and airy.
- Incorporate eggs individually, thoroughly mixing after each addition to ensure a smooth, homogeneous batter.
- Introduce vanilla extract, pumpkin puree, and mashed bananas, stirring until the wet ingredients are completely integrated.
- Gently fold the dry ingredient mixture into the wet ingredients, stirring minimally to avoid overmixing and maintain a tender texture.
- Transfer the batter into the prepared loaf pan, using a spatula to create an even surface and eliminate any air pockets.
- Position the pan in the preheated oven and bake for approximately 60-70 minutes, monitoring until a inserted toothpick emerges clean and dry.
- Let the bread rest in the pan for 10 minutes to stabilize its structure, then carefully remove and place on a cooling rack.
- Allow the bread to cool completely before slicing to ensure clean, precise cuts and optimal texture.
Notes
- Ensure butter is at room temperature for smooth creaming and better texture.
- Overripe bananas provide maximum sweetness and deeper flavor profile.
- Use fresh, high-quality spices to boost the pumpkin spice aroma and taste.
- Replace butter with coconut oil for a dairy-free alternative that maintains moisture.
